Additional Information

The Mental Health First Aid course does not train people to be mental health workers. It offers basic general information about mental health problems.

The knowledge presented and understanding developed in the course helps to remove stigma and fear and to give confidence in approaching a person in distress.

The Mental Health First Aid Course is an initial response to distress and all participants on the course understand that this help is given only until other suitable or professional help can be found.
